Ex-policeman arraigned for stealing phone
Judiciary
A 24-year-old dismissed police officer, Olayiwola Felix has been arraigned before an Osun State Magistrate Court, Osogbo, for allegedly stealing a phone and cash belonging to a police applicant.
Police prosecutor Idoko John told the court that the suspect on August 24, 2020 at about 8:30pm at Nigeria police Headquarters Osogbo stole a bag containing one Tecno Camon 12 mobile phone, valued at N58, 000 and N25, 000 belonging to one Ajibola Bolaji, a police applicant.
He pleaded not guilty, and Magistrate Modupe Awodele granted him bail.
The case was adjourned till November 9, for hearing.
